Just off Allure yesterday. Per the Captain and Hotel Director, they are adding more suites, suite only restaurant, moving izumi down to the private dining area inorder to expand the windjammer seating, setting up the dynamic dining arrangements (although wont be active until at least 4th quarter), carpeting, changing ritas to sabor, and some other arrangements. She crosses next week then drydock.

The statement about the VCL is incorrect. The chapel and associated lounge are being changed into high end suites just as on Oasis. The VCL is being converted to Costal Kitchen and the Suite Lounge, also as on Oasis. The Suite Loung and Costal are for Suite guests Grand Suites and above. Costal Kitchen serves breakfast, lunch and dinner. The Suite Lounge serves drinks from 5:00 to 8:30. Chefs Table is also now located in the old VCL. The old Concerge Lounge on deck 11, and 12 is now the Diamond Lounge
